NEGITIV Teams Up with GRAVEDGR on ‘RAKATA’
Cologne-based DJ and producer NEGITIV has made waves in the electronic dance music scene since her emergence in 2024. Now, she returns with an electrifying new single, ‘RAKATA,’ collaborating once again with American hard dance artist GRAVEDGR. This track is released through MUTATE Records, a newly launched hard techno imprint from Insomniac, and signifies both artists’ unwavering commitment to pushing the boundaries of their craft.
A Collaboration Reimagined
‘RAKATA’ marks the reunion between NEGITIV and GRAVEDGR, following their previous collaboration on the 2025 EP ‘See You in My Dreams / Not In My League.’ With this new single, NEGITIV aims to make a bold statement as she kicks off her release schedule for 2026. The Mutate Records Promise
Released under MUTATE Records, which launched in early 2026, ‘RAKATA’ sits at the forefront of the harder electronic music evolution. Emerging from the phenomenally successful Insomniac MUTATE party series, the label embraces a diverse range of genres, including hard techno, hardgroove, acid, psy, and fast-rave hybrids. With a commitment to an artist-first approach, MUTATE empowers its producers by allowing them to retain ownership of their work while providing uncompromising club-focused releases. The label’s roster boasts other notable names like Charlie Sparks and AZYR, establishing itself as a significant player in the hard techno landscape.
NEGITIV: A Rising Star
For NEGITIV, whose real name is Negin Paknia, the release of ‘RAKATA’ comes at a pivotal juncture in her career. Known for an emotionally charged approach to hard techno, she excels in crafting sets that balance intensity with precision. Her sound draws influence from industrial techno, schranz, and high-energy rave music, aiming to push energy boundaries on the dance floor.
This release coincides with her extensive ‘Me & My Demons’ Tour, where she performs at prestigious venues across Europe and Asia, including the Verknipt Ziggo Dome and Terminal V Festival. This tour not only solidifies her growing international presence but also underscores her commitment to expanding her reach within the rapidly changing hard techno landscape.
